Download for 1280x960 resolutionThis motive is a magnification at the top of the earlier deviation Colorful Portal. This top contains of an infinite hierarchy of portals nestled to each other. I’ve taken the first one. This portal however have not an island in the lower region that contains a copy of the Cubic Mandelbrot set, so I then dived into in to a small dot under the copy of the Nonic Mandelbrot set. The lucky ones of my watchers that have UF may run the parameter file and perform several out-zooms (shift + left button drag down).
Ultra Fractal, formula Heptic Parameterspace3 in the sp3-module written by my dear friend Stig Pettersson, Greenseng here at DeviantART. All his modules, as well as mine can be downloaded from [link]
